KRM KANYA BIJNAUR
Last Updated at 11 October 2024KRM KANYA BIJNAUR: A Girls' Upper Primary School in Lucknow
KRM KANYA BIJNAUR is a government-run upper primary school located in the SAROJNI NAGAR block of the LUCKNOW district in Uttar Pradesh. Established in 1972, the school serves the rural community and provides education for girls from Class 6 to Class 8.
The school offers an education that is tailored to the needs of its female students, with a focus on academic excellence. The medium of instruction at KRM KANYA BIJNAUR is Hindi, reflecting the local language and culture. The school is well-equipped with essential resources to foster learning, including 3 classrooms in good condition, a separate room for the head teacher, and a library with 492 books.
KRM KANYA BIJNAUR prioritizes the well-being of its students, providing a clean and safe environment with functional hand pumps for drinking water, a playground for recreation, and separate boys' and girls' toilets.
While the school does not offer a pre-primary section, it provides a supportive learning environment with seven dedicated female teachers. The school also benefits from a functional electricity connection and a Pucca But Broken boundary wall, ensuring the safety and security of the students.
The school's commitment to its students extends beyond academics. KRM KANYA BIJNAUR provides mid-day meals, ensuring that students receive nutritious meals prepared within the school premises. This ensures that students are well-nourished and ready to learn.
The school, despite its lack of computer-aided learning facilities, is accessible to all students, with ramps for disabled children and a playground for recreation.
